    big ass moneyline parlays.... need feedback, thank you

    what's up fellas.... i pop in and out of here on and off throughout the sports calendar, which is indicative that I start out with peanuts and go broke often....

    anyway, I am back, trying to put together an old strategy that I have tried to use and with others here had decent success with in NCAAB, particularly in March madness....

    the idea is, huge ML favs teamed together in ML parlays that offer a return that has some value... seeing that online books actually offer ML for the 20 point favs, it seems like it could work the same in NCAAF....

    In my quick count of last season, 17+ home favs won straight up at a 132-12 clip last year... seems to me to indicate by making these plays, you will pick up a loss or two over the season, bit there is a chance at a profit....

    Last week I jumped in and put together a 15 team ML parlay with 14 of the teams as 17 or better point favs, all 14 of those teams won straight up... my mistake, going against the strategy and plugging in ND as number 15 to make the payout 3-1 when the payout for the first 14 was even money already...
